One late night, Yamamoto, a college student working part-time at a convenience store, reunites with Hayashi Megumi, his high school classmate and the most beautiful girl in their class. Known as the "Queen" for her strong-willed and arrogant personality, Yamamoto had always found her difficult to get along with. However, during a routine conversation, he notices painful bruises on her wrist. After learning that her boyfriend had been abusing her, Yamamoto decides to let Hayashi stay at his place...!?
Matsukoma, a part-time employee of a late-night convenience store, takes the newbie Tomoharu Nii under his wing. Tomoharu, dubbed Nietzsche-sensei, is a university student studying Buddhism. During a heated exchange with an irate customer who insists "Customers are gods," Tomoharu retorts that "God is dead." The manga chronicles Matsukoma and Tomoharu's experiences as part-time workers, with Tomoharu's peculiar behavior and responses repeatedly confounding both his colleagues and customers.
Emilico is a Living Doll in the Shadows House, alongside many others who serve the mansion's completely black, soot-emitting residents. Each "Shadow" has a corresponding Doll, and Emilico must keep the house immaculate while also representing her master Kate. Despite their roles, Kate treats Emilico as a friend and confidant. The mysterious nature of the partnership between these two groups is further complicated by the overseers on the upper levels of the mansion, their motives unknown. On an unfamiliar mountain during summer, Jin Konohana finds himself stranded. His sister had coerced him into carrying her belongings to a fireworks show and abandoned him alone in the wilderness. With the goal of achieving a peaceful and stress-free existence, Jin starts a survival journey to rid himself of any burdensome worries.

Once an ordinary family enamored with cats, the Tanaka family experienced a tragic demise in the hands of a massive earthquake. Miraculously, they were reborn as the prestigious Stuart clan in a different realm. Despite adopting the Western fashion, they vividly recall their past lives in Japan. Although initially bewildered, they have gradually adapted to their newfound existence.
The daughter of a duke, Catarina Claes, at the age of eight, suffers a head injury that leads to a startling realization - she has recollected memories of a past life, and she now finds herself trapped in a world resembling the otome game she once played, where she is tasked with being the game's antagonist. In every possible conclusion, whether it be exile or death, Catarina is faced with a tragic end. Using her knowledge of how the game plays out, Catarina must do everything within her power to shape her destiny. From honing her farming skills to befriending each character that crosses her path, she's up for the task, and over the years, everything seems to go according to plan. But then, Catarina realizes the mistake she made in her previous life - she never finished the game before dying, and this oversight could now undo all of her hard work since a new covert route presents itself.
Kaoru Terazaki and Nanami play an online game using fake identities, with Kaoru choosing a female persona and Nanami going for a male avatar. Things take an interesting turn when they decide to meet up in real life - Kaoru is a boy, and Nanami turns out to be a girl. Distressed about their initial misrepresentations, Nanami fabricates a scheme where Kaoru dresses up in women's apparel to conceal their true gender identities. Despite the initial sham, their unconventional meeting results in an extraordinary connection between the two strangers.
My name is Daisy von Preslaria and I was born into a viscount family that was famous for producing outstanding magicians. However, I was not blessed with magical abilities and instead was designated the role of an alchemist, which was seen as a failure in my family. But, I am determined to showcase my competence and become a self-reliant and adept alchemist. From the young age of five, I began experimenting with potion-making, and with the aid of my concealed Appraisal skill, my concoctions surpassed those of any other alchemist. I committed myself to cultivating medicinal herbs, researching alchemy, gathering ingredients, and even established my own store. This is the account of an easy-going but zealous alchemist, supported by a varied group of individuals, including non-humans.
Although she was a young horror writer, Bambi never believed in the supernatural. Her lack of belief made it easy for her to rent an apartment where a suicide had occurred. When her serialization was canceled, she was asked to write a short story based on a true experience. It wasn't until then that Bambi noticed the presence of a spirit in her apartment. The ghost was an amnesiac high school girl named Ako who was talkative and harmless. Bambi gained Ako's permission to use her as inspiration for her next project. However, there was another Ako: Yamashiro Ako, a melancholic high school girl who dreamed every night from the spirit's viewpoint.
